Answer:
B is at the origin. D is on the x-axis.
Step-by-step explanation:
For a point to be at the origin, it lies at the intersection of both the x- axis and the y - axis. Both axes intersect at the origin. So, point B is at the origin.
For a point to be on the x - axis, its coordinate on the y- axis is zero. So, for a point on the x- axis with coordinate, x, it is the point (x,0) and it lies on the x axis. So, point D is on the x - axis.
For a point to be on the y - axis, its coordinate on the x - axis is zero. So, for a point on the y- axis with coordinate, y, it is the point (0,y) and it lies on the x axis. So, point A is on the y - axis.
The point C which is at (1,2) lies in the plane x-y since it has both x and y coordinates.

Step-by-step explanation:
The symbol ^ means raised to a power.
Formula for Volume of Sphere - V = 4/3 π r^3
1. To find the volume of a sphere, first find the radius with the given diameter 16.
16 ÷ 2 = 8
Radius = 8
2. Substitute r for 8 and solve, and 3 will be used for π.
V ≈ 4/3 • 3 • 8^3
V ≈ 4/3 • 3 • 512
V ≈ 4/3 • 1536
V ≈ 6144/3
V ≈ 2,048
